How Our Sanitization & Disinfection Services Work
When you hire our team for Sanitization & Disinfection Services, you’re getting a thorough process that focuses on your health and safety. We use specialized equipment, including thermal imaging cameras and moisture meters, to identify and address the root cause of the issue. This process typically takes 3-5 days to complete, depending on the severity of the damage.
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our technicians will conduct a thorough visual inspection of your property to identify the affected areas. This step typically takes 1-2 hours and allows us to create a customized plan to address your specific needs.
Step 2: Equipment Setup and Deployment
We’ll deploy our advanced equipment, such as industrial-sized air scrubbers and dehumidifiers, to remove moisture and contaminants from the affected area. This step usually takes 2-4 hours to complete.
Step 3: Sanitization and Disinfection
Next, our team will apply specialized disinfectants to remove bacteria, viruses, and fungi from the affected area. This step typically takes 2-4 hours to complete.
Step 4: Drying and Restoration
Finally, our technicians will use industrial-grade drying equipment to remove excess moisture from the affected area. This step usually takes 2-5 days to complete.

Warning Signs You Need Sanitization & Disinfection Services
Catching these warning sign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ore these red flags: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, persistent odors in your home or business can show a hidden moisture issue or bacterial growth. Don’t wait until the problem spreads.
Water Stains and Warping
Visible water stains or warping on wal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of a more serious issue. Address the problem now to avoid costly repairs.
Unexplained Allergies or Health Issues
Do you or a family member experience unexplained allergies or health issues? It could be related to hidden mold growth or bacterial contamination.
Visible Mold Growth
Don’t wait until mold growth becomes a visible, active issue. Our team can help you address the problem before it spreads.
Unpleasant Moisture or Humidity Levels
Excessive moisture or humidity in your home or business can create an ideal environment for mold growth and bacterial contamination.
Recent Water Damage or Flooding
Unaddressed water damage or flooding can lead to serious health risks and costly repairs. Don’t wait to address the issue.
